4 Frequently Asked Questions about "Photovoltaic panels affect the operation of medical equipment"
Are solar panels a viable option for medical facilities?
Innovations in solar panel efficiency and durability are improving the economic viability of solar energy solutions in healthcare. Implementing solar energy systems in medical facilities faces challenges such as high upfront costs, limited space for solar panel installation, and regulatory barriers.
Do solar panels affect the aesthetics of healthcare facilities?
Controversies may arise regarding the visual impact of solar panels on the aesthetics of healthcare facilities. However, careful planning, financial incentives, and architectural considerations can address these challenges and controversies.
Are solar panels a cost-saving option for healthcare facilities?
Integrating solar panels into their infrastructure offers substantial cost-saving opportunities: Reduced Energy Bills: Solar panels generate electricity from sunlight, offsetting a significant portion of a healthcare facility's energy consumption.
Can solar panels be used in healthcare facilities?
Healthcare facilities often have limited rooftop space or parking lots where solar panels can be installed. However, innovative solutions such as solar carports or ground-mounted solar arrays can be utilized to overcome this challenge and maximize the use of available space.
